Royal Air Force (RAF) Cranwell was used for flying training with the formation of the RAF in 1918. Soon after, the RAF College was established here for the training of RAF Officer Cadets. This aerial view focuses on Cranwell's principal college building, College Hall, which was built between 1929 and 1933 to designs by Office of Works architect James Grey West.
